Winpopup LAN Messenger is a basic network messaging software for sending pop-up messages over a local area network. It allows users connected on the same LAN to send and receive short messages in pop-up windows.
Secure Copy (SCP) is a network protocol used to securely transfer files between a local and a remote host or between two remote hosts. It uses SSH for data transfer and provides the same authentication and same level of security as SSH.
